Exploring the Mysterious Star

If you’ve spent any time navigating the Coinbase platform, you’ve likely come across the star symbol. It resides prominently next to cryptocurrencies, and its presence often raises questions. So, what does the star mean on Coinbase?

The star on Coinbase serves as a bookmarking feature. In essence, it allows users to mark specific cryptocurrencies or assets as favorites. Think of it as a way to create a personalized watchlist of cryptocurrencies that are of particular interest to you. When you star a cryptocurrency, it becomes easily accessible from your Coinbase dashboard, saving you the trouble of scrolling through a long list of assets every time you log in.

How to Use the Star Feature

Understanding the purpose of the star is one thing, but knowing how to use it effectively is another. Let’s explore how you can utilize this feature to enhance your Coinbase experience.

Adding Cryptocurrencies to Your Favorites: To star a cryptocurrency, simply click on the star icon next to its name. Once you do this, the star will turn yellow, indicating that the asset has been added to your favorites list.

Accessing Your Favorites: To view your favorite cryptocurrencies, go to your Coinbase dashboard. You will notice a section labeled “Favorites” where all the assets you’ve starred will be displayed for quick access.

Managing Your Favorites: If your list of favorite cryptocurrencies grows, you can manage them by clicking on the “Manage” button in the “Favorites” section. Here, you can add or remove assets from your list as your investment strategy evolves.
